Gräns / Border (2018) - A customs officer who can smell fear develops an unusual attraction to a strange traveler while aiding a police investigation which will call into question her entire existence.
This crime-drama/romance was a disturbing watch that stayed with me long afterward. I found out later it had the same screenwriter as one of my favorite films Let the Right One In so that makes sense. 8/10
